Many Gladstone-area families start with information from national websites, news stories, or AI-driven summaries. That can feel helpful at first—but for legal purposes, what matters is your documented exposure window and your medical record timeline.
In practical terms, residents run into common issues:
- medical visits spread across multiple providers (and years)
- incomplete discharge summaries or missing test results
- uncertainty about dates—especially when remembering base housing or duty assignments
- questions about whether an illness is “in the right category”
A strong consultation focuses on aligning where you were and when you were there with how your symptoms and diagnoses evolved.
